Eva’s last memorable moment with her son comes as she was busy filming her next feature film, which is based on the award-winning novel of the same name by Sandra Barneda. It would consist of six episodes and would be shot in English and Spanish. Eva plays Gala, who is “an empty nest in New York whose life is turned upside down when her husband involves the family in financial irregularities, and she is forced to flee town alongside her aging mother and aged daughter. academic”, in the series, according to Daily Mail.
“The three women hide in a wine town in Spain, after the disappearance of her husband, while escaping the dangerous criminals to whom Gala’s husband is indebted,” the outlet added. “The Spanish town where the family fled, Gala’s mother was previously theirs 50 years ago and swore never to return. Gossip begins to spread through the small town and the secrets and truths of the families begin to unfold.
